Review of the Indigenous Legal Assistance Program (ILAP)

The following comments are provided in response to the matters raised in the Review of the Indigenous Legal Assistance Program Discussion Paper (Discussion Paper) produced by Cox Inall Ridgeway (the Reviewer).

The Law Council’s submission is informed by its collaboration with the National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Legal Services (NATSILS), as well as the Law Council’s ongoing membership of the Change the Record Coalition and Australian Legal Assistance Forum. The Law Council supports the submissions of these bodies to this review, and in particular highlights the important role of NATSILS in supporting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Legal Services (ATSILS) and ensuring that the objectives and outcomes of the ILAP are achieved.
